Once upon a time, in a vast sandy desert, lived a kind doctor named Pole. He wore a white coat and always carried a small bag filled with medical tools and water.
One scorching day, Doctor Pole spotted a small tent. Near it, an old man lay in the shade, looking very weak.
Doctor Pole rushed to the old man, whose face was wrinkled like the dry desert ground, and asked, 'Can I help you, sir?'
The old man whispered, 'Water...' Doctor Pole quickly gave him some water and watched the man sip slowly.
After a few minutes, the old man felt better. He told Doctor Pole that he got lost when looking for the famous desert flower.
Doctor Pole knew about the flower, which bloomed once every ten years. 'It's rare, but I can help you find it,' said Doctor Pole.
They journeyed together, following tracks left by desert animals. The sun was hot, but they shared stories to pass the time.
Finally, they saw something pink peeking out of the sand. 'The desert flower!' they both exclaimed in joy.
Doctor Pole and the old man admired the flower's beauty. 'You saved me and helped me reach my dream,' the old man smiled.
As the sun set, Doctor Pole and the old man walked back to the tent. The desert now seemed a friendlier place.
Back at the tent, Doctor Pole made sure the old man was okay. They had supper under the stars, the old man's spirits lifted.
From that day on, Doctor Pole was known as the doctor who not only healed the sick but also healed hearts by kindness.
